The question

What is the ruling on exchanging gifts by lot among a group of people if the gift is of a previously agreed-upon value, and some of them did not adhere to that value? Is this considered usury (riba), and if so, how should the excess money be handled?

The answer

This action falls under the category of reciprocal transactions, and a gift intended for reward is considered a sale. A sale requires knowledge of the price and the item being sold. The ignorance of what each will receive through the lottery contains an element of gambling, so it is not permissible. Therefore, each person must reclaim their gift, and they should not revert to such an action.
